Horticulture was first practiced in the … WebApr 11, 2024 · Place the hawthorn plant into the hole, spreading out the roots within it, then fill the soil back in around the roots and firm it into place. Water in your new hawthorn, then mulch around the base of the plant with organic mulch, but take care not to mound it around the base of the trunk or stems.

WebApr 23, 2024 · With the magic of grafting, you can have both. Grafting is a horticultural practice in which a branch or bud of one plant is attached to another plant. Practically every commercially available fruit tree or rose bush has been grafted.
